Carl Blais is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Mechanics of Materials and Materials Chemistry.
According to data from OpenAlex, Carl Blais has authored 69 papers receiving a total of 608 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 58 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 26 papers in Mechanics of Materials and 22 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Carl Blais’s work include Powder Metallurgy Techniques and Materials (23 papers), Advanced materials and composites (18 papers) and Metal Alloys Wear and Properties (17 papers). Carl Blais is often cited by papers focused on Powder Metallurgy Techniques and Materials (23 papers), Advanced materials and composites (18 papers) and Metal Alloys Wear and Properties (17 papers). Carl Blais coll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and India. Carl Blais's co-authors include Sandra Pelletier, Roger E. Hernández, Robert Schulz, Houshang Alamdari and Sylvio Savoie and has published in prestigious journals such as Materials Science and Engineering A, Journal of Materials Science and Journal of Alloys and Compounds.
